> In case of diff_dst (src != dst), is there any assumption / convention
> regarding allocation length of req->src and req->dst - are they supposed be
> equal, even if it's not needed?
> For example, in case of diff_dst && encryption, currently both req->src and
> req->dst have then length = template[i].ilen + authsize. Shouldn't length of
> req->src be template[i].ilen, i.e. no space allocated for ICV?
You're right, in diff_dst case, sg and sgout could be different size. That's
what I thought at first, and so I changed the above part to:
if (diff_dst) {
output = xoutbuf[0];
output += align_offset;
sg_init_one(&sg[0], input, template[i].ilen);
sg_init_one(&sgout[0], output,
template[i].rlen);
} else {
sg_init_one(&sg[0], input,
template[i].ilen +
(enc ? authsize : 0));
output = input;
}
But this causes scatterwalk.c to throw BUG:
